[CRYPTO] blkcipher: Fix handling of kmalloc page straddling

The function blkcipher_get_spot tries to return a buffer of
the specified length that does not straddle a page.  It has
an off-by-one bug so it may advance a page unnecessarily.

What's worse, one of its callers doesn't provide a buffer
that's sufficiently long for this operation.

This patch fixes both problems.  Thanks to Bob Gilligan for
diagnosing this problem and providing a fix.
